Windows XP automatically starts with a command prompt as a system shell. Steps: Open the registry (Regedit) in the start, and then find hkey_local_machine\\Software\\MIcrosoft\\WindowsNT\\CUrrentVersion\\Winlogo to find it. Shell key, double-click to change the default Explorer.exe to cmd.exe. After you register and log in, the result of the change will take effect.
